Basement concrete installation services involve preparing and pouring a durable concrete slab to form the foundation or flooring of a basement. This process typically includes assessing the space, ensuring proper leveling, and applying the right mixture to create a strong, long-lasting surface. Skilled contractors may also incorporate additional features such as reinforcement with rebar or wire mesh to improve the concrete’s strength and prevent cracking over time. The goal is to provide a solid, stable base that can support various basement uses, whether for storage, living space, or finishing projects.
These services help address common basement problems such as uneven or cracked floors, water intrusion issues, and structural instability. An improperly installed or deteriorating concrete slab can lead to uneven flooring, moisture problems, and potential damage to the foundation. By investing in professional concrete installation, homeowners can improve the integrity of their basement, reduce the risk of future repairs, and create a safer environment. Properly installed concrete also helps prevent moisture seepage, which can lead to mold growth and other indoor air quality concerns.

The overview below groups typical Basement Concrete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or concrete repairs in basements range from $250 to $600. Many routine patching or crack sealing projects fall within this range, though prices can vary based on extent of damage and location.
Surface Resurfacing - Resurfacing or coating existing basement floors usually costs between $1,000 and $3,000. Most projects are completed within this range, with larger or more intricate finishes potentially reaching higher prices.
Full Basement Floor Replacement - Replacing an entire basement concrete slab generally costs from $4,000 to $8,000. Larger, more complex installations can exceed this range, but many projects fall into the middle of this spectrum.
Basement Foundation Construction - Building a new basement foundation can range from $15,000 to $30,000 or more. These larger projects tend to be at the higher end, while smaller or simpler foundations may cost less, with many jobs in the middle range.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
